Power consumption
Whenever i run my radar detector, radio and 180 watt power inverter for my laptop, i blow a fuse. It usually takes a while - last time it happened i was good for about 4 hours - but eventually the fuse for the cig lighter/power outlets and stereo blows. Is there any way around this?

I believe the radio and cig power outlet are both connected to a 15 amp fuse.
14 volts X 15 amps = 210 watts
You could probably put a 20 amp fuse in there but I wouldn't reccomend it because the wires might not be able to handle the excess power draw. I would look into running some wires from the battery, through the firewall and into the cabin.
